Andreas Nolte, Managing Director of Nolte aktiv-markt GmbH, a company that owns several supermarkets under the Edeka Group which is one of the largest food grocers in Germany, says in his presentation that since 2009 transcritical CO2 systems and subcritical hybrid cascade systems have been the preferred choice at Edeka Südwest. As a result, today Edeka Südwest has 106 transcritical CO2 refrigeration systems and 59 subcritical hybrid cascade systems in operation.

About the speaker(s)

Andreas Nolte

 

Andreas Nolte has been active in Nolte aktiv-markt GmbH, a company which owns several supermarkets operating under the EDEKA brand, since 1993. He assumed the role of Managing Director in 1995 and is responsibe for the areas of Finance, Electronic data processing and Procurement. With the building of the new store in Königstein, Andreas also assumed responsibility for Sustainable development at Nolte aktiv-markt GmbH. The first big project is the implementation of a CO2 system at the Königstein store.
